The objective of the Odyssey Challenge is to foster kindness and enhance awareness of disabilities within the realm of sports. This initiative will be implemented across lots of educational institutions and community clubs that wish to engage in this programme. 

Various groups, such as Cubs, Scouts, Police Cadets, and schools, have embraced the Odyssey Challenge. Through the promotion of kindness and the elevation of disability awareness, we aspire to inspire children to       engage in acts of kindness and to extend compassion towards others. Respect and kindness are fundamental attributes in all sports, and we aim to promote this through this initiative. 

Additionally, we intend to heighten  and raise awareness of local emergency services and to cultivate positive relationships between these services and their respective communities.

Kindness 

Participants will undertake a specified number of acts of kindness to fulfil their exciting challenge. Each child will select a challenge: completing 30 acts of kindness will earn them a challenge coin, while achieving 50 acts of kindness will result in the award of a medal.

Citizenship

A commitment to raise funds for the Intrepid Games Foundation, with a very small target of £30 per child.

These funds will significantly support the yearly organisation of the Intrepid Games for emergency services. This teaches about citizenship and the principles of fund-raising.

Disability Sport 

Our fundraising efforts will benefit the Intrepid Games Foundation, contributing to the increased recognition of existing disability clubs within our communities. The   criteria for participation include a visit to a local disability club to gain insight into the sport offered by that club (with adult supervision required) or in some cases we are able to bring the sport to you.

Medals Presentation

Part of our agreement is that we will always endeavour to have an emergency services worker to present the medals and challenge coins in your school.  

Please note this isn't always possible.
